    This chapter of the book is devoted to the study of determinantal singularities of analytic spaces with an emphasis on deformation theory, elementary methods of classification and related computational methods with applications. It consists of five parts, a list of 114 references on relevant articles and 18 classification tables of simple singularities of various kinds and types, most of which were obtained by the authors in a series of earlier works (see, e.g., [\textit{A. Frühbis-Krüger}, Commun. Algebra 27, No. 8, 3993--4013 (1999; Zbl 0963.14011); \textit{A. Frühbis-Krüger} and \textit{A. Neumer}, Commun. Algebra 38, No. 2, 454--495 (2010; Zbl 1193.32015); \textit{M. Zach}, Topology of isolated determinantal singularities. (PhD Thesis) (2017)]).\N\NThe authors begin with preliminary materials and a collection of facts known to them concerning singularities of matrices and determinantal varieties. Among other things they discuss the basic properties of determinantal ideals and their free resolutions, deformations of determinantal singularities, the concepts of unfoldings and equivalence of matrices, finite determinacy, versality, etc. Then the theory of essentially isolated determinantal singularities is considered in detail including the Tyurina transformation for such singularities and their deformations, possible generalizations, modifications and so on (see [\textit{A. Frühbis-Krüger}, Topology Appl. 234, 375--396 (2018; Zbl 1405.32038)]). In the next two parts, they discuss the classification problem of simple complete intersections, Cohen-Macaulay singularities of codimension 2, Gorenstein singularities of codimension 3, rational surface singularities, singularities of square matrices, and some other types. The last part is concerned to analysis of the topology of essential smoothings of essentially isolated determinantal singularities, explicit constructions of smoothings, some special properties of determinantal hypersurfaces, isolated Cohen-Macaulay singularities of codimension 2 and some other particular cases and applications, including properties of hypersurfaces with nonisolated singularities, bouquet decompositions for essential smoothings (see [\textit{M. Zach}, J. Singul. 22, 190--204 (2020; Zbl 1451.14007)]), formulas for the vanishing Euler characteristic and complex links of essential smoothings, etc.\N\NIt should be especially noted that the exposition is illustrated with 12 excellent colour pictures with interesting comments and useful remarks.\N\NFor the entire collection see [Zbl 1545.32001].
